Nota
O acesso a esta página requer autorização. Podes tentar iniciar sessão ou mudar de diretório.
O acesso a esta página requer autorização. Podes tentar mudar de diretório.
Indica o escopo específico de um valor de dados.
Syntax
enum DataKind {
DataIsUnknown,
DataIsLocal,
DataIsStaticLocal,
DataIsParam,
DataIsObjectPtr,
DataIsFileStatic,
DataIsGlobal,
DataIsMember,
DataIsStaticMember,
DataIsConstant
};
Elementos
| Elemento | Descrição |
|---|---|
| DataIsUnknown | O símbolo de dados não pode ser determinado. |
| DataIsLocal | O item de dados é uma variável local. |
| DataIsStaticLocal | O item de dados é uma variável local estática. |
| DataIsParam | O item de dados é um parâmetro formal. |
| DataIsObjectPtr | O item de dados é um ponteiro de objeto (this). |
| DataIsFileStatic | O item de dados é uma variável com escopo de arquivo. |
| DataIsGlobal | O item de dados é uma variável global. |
| DataIsMember | O item de dados é uma variável de membro do objeto. |
| DataIsStaticMember | O item de dados é uma variável estática de classe. |
| DataIsConstant | O item de dados é um valor constante. |
Comentários
Os valores nessa enumeração são retornados pelo método IDiaSymbol::get_dataKind.
Requisitos
Cabeçalho: cvconst.h